The goal of this clinical research study is to find the recommended safe dose of TGFBR2 KO CAR27/IL-15 NK cells that can be given to patients with relapsed/refractory disease. The safety and effectiveness of this treatment will also be studied.

This is a phase I/II, two-arm, open-label study. The study will have a phase I dose-escalation portion using a standard "BOIN" approach to determine the MTD of the CAR.70/IL15-transduced/TGFBR2KO CB-NK cells, followed by phase II expansions of 2 arms: 1.) patients with relapsed/refractory AML and 2.) patients with MDS/CMML after HMA failure.
Up to 12 patients will be enrolled in the phase I portion of the study. Following determination of the recommended phase 2 dose (RP2D), 20 patients will be enrolled into the AML arm and 10 patients will be enrolled into the MDS/CMML arm (30 patients total in phase II).
The regimen consists of lymphodepleting and priming chemotherapy with dexamethasone, decitabine, fludarabine and cyclophosphamide, followed by a one-time infusion of the CAR.70/IL15-transduced/TGFBR2KO CB-NK cells
